Output 571353121d64c4f53b44493a2800f2525b4668ee8158b25427f862efcaf33333:7

value
175700
script pubkey
OP_0 OP_PUSHBYTES_20 312961d1f01ea3ecaea31b27d7376ac300e21479
address
bc1qxy5kr50sr637et4rrvnawdm2cvqwy9recgsmcx
transaction
571353121d64c4f53b44493a2800f2525b4668ee8158b25427f862efcaf33333
confirmations
155165
spent
true